Objective of the Course:
Making the student achieve the skills of reading Qur’an in a proper and beautiful way by using his voice beautifully and applying different tones while reading it.

Learning Outcomes:
1
Being able to distinguish the open or hidden mistakes in the nuances of Mahreç and Sıfat of the letters that might come along during the reading.; ;
2
Understanding the appliance of different methods in the teaching of Qur’an ; ;
3
Being able to read Qur’an in a proper and beautiful way by using the voice beautifully and applying different tones while reading it; ;
4
Being able to use the Segah and Hüzzam tones in the Tilavet of Qur’an; ;
5
Being able to distinguish the reading types of the Koran and the differences among them; ;
6
Being able to benefit from Hadr, Tedvir and Tahkik techniques while reading the memorized Surahs; ;
7
Acquainting the Qur’anic verses in the proper time and place during every kind of religious and social activity, initially Mosques and small mosques.; ;
8
Being able to read as Aşır in these kind of activities the verses of the Surahs Lokman 31/25-30, En’am 6/159-163, Ahzab 33/70-73 and Neml 27/89-93; ;
9
Being able to perform the professional implementations like Imam, Müezzin and etc.; ;
10
Having an advanced culture of the Qur’an within the framework of the topics studied in the class; ;
